Trail De Montbazon is a small nature-running event in Montbazon, Indre-et-Loire, held at the foot of the town’s medieval fortress. The program is designed for adults and children: adults choose between roughly 8.5-9 km and 17-18 km trail races, while younger runners get 600 m, 800 m, and 1.2 km races. Adult entries are capped at 200, keeping it closer to a local club race than a large anonymous trail festival.
The adult routes use repeated loops: two loops for the shorter race and four for the longer one. The terrain is not mountainous, with about 50 m of climbing on the short trail and about 100 m on the long trail. The race suits regular runners, casual runners, and families bringing children for the shorter events. Montbaz’Run organizes it, and the day ends in a very French local-race way: paella, a refreshment bar, and an evening with music after the running is done.
